FUEL CELL OPTIMUM OPERATION POINT TRACKING SYSTEM IN POWER SUPPLY DEVICE USING FUEL CELL, AND POWER SUPPLY DEVICE PROVIDED WITH THIS FUEL CELL OPTIMUM OPERATION POINT TRACKING SYSTEM |
摘要 |
A fuel cell optimum operation point tracking system for detecting the optimum operating voltage of a fuel cell allowing for not only temperature dependency but chemical reaction as output characteristics to enable the optimum operation of a fuel cell. The fuel cell optimum operation point tracking system is characterized by comprising a fuel cell output voltage variaion instructing means (11) that changes a voltage output by a fuel cell (1) to up to the maximum voltage of a maximum power point tracking control when a power supply device (2) is started, a fuel cell output power measuring means (12) that measures its power condition, a fuel cell maximum power point judging means (13) that monitors an output power measured by the fuel cell output power measuring means to judge the maximum power point of a fuel cell output power, and an optimum operation point variation instructing means (15) that gives a minute voltage variation amount near the current operating voltage value while constantly keeping a power supply operation in a stable condition to thereby monitor a maximum power and track an optimum operation point. |
